University-Business Agreement
Agrifood AT jointly participated in two practical sessions on the use of computer solutions for farm management and data consolidation (15 February) and another on computer solutions for the formulation and optimization of compound feedingstuffs (23 March). Both sessions were directed to the attendants to the Master in Swine Health and Production.
We thank Pedro López (Director of BDPorc) and Eduardo Angulo (Cathedratic Professor) the opportunity to teach future technicians a business vision focused on the problems they will face after their university stage.
The solutions used by both our clients and the students were the FARM to manage a sow farm, the Multi Site Reporting to show how an integrator would consolidate the data of its different farms and Brill® Formulation for the formulation and optimization of compound feed.
